ISDS

We had a successful meeting on this subject earlier in the year, this got a mention in Think Global. We now have a new case that National are encouraging us to support. It is the case of a mining company developing a mine in Armenia. Previous mines have contaminated water sources so there a local community action against this company but they intend to start an ISDS case seeking an amount equivalent to two-thirds of the country’s annual budget.

Trade Justice

The Trade Bill is still going through Parliament. The main focus of campaigning now is on a future UK-US trade deal if or when we leave the EU. The main risks of this are to food safety, the NHS and climate change. We discussed the Soil Association research which points out the significant differences in standards in the two countries and the fact that apparently annual incidents of food poisoning in the US are 14% higher than in the UK.

Meeting on Corporate Courts

June 17, 2019 by GJ Cleveland

Open Meeting on Corporate Courts Held on 15th May 2019ISDS leaflet image

 We joined with the Teesside Socialist Campaign Group to have an education meeting on the subject of ISDS (Investor State Dispute Settlement) which is a little known element of many trade deals. We used the Global Justice power point which attempted to explain the serious impact that Corporate Courts can have on the attempts of individual countries to enforce rules that will protect both people and the planet.

ISDS gives special rights to foreign investors that no one else has, not domestic companies and not ordinary people. It allows corporations to bypass national justice systems and undermine the laws of democratic states. The companies have their own justice systems where everything is set up in their favour. The courts do not have to uphold human rights law or international environmental law. There is no appeal process, the cases are held in secret and the arbitrators are not independent, they are private lawyers, paid by the case, so there is a built in financial interest to deliver outcomes favourable to investors. he ISDS system has already undermined civil society struggles in a number of countries. Often governments simply cannot afford to respond to concerns about pollution or deforestation because of the threat of an ISDS case and the huge amount of compensation that companies would be seeking.
